About Mayra
Welcome to my JacketFlap Page! I am a multi-genre author, book reviewer, and animal advocate.
In the children's category, my works include THE MAGIC VIOLIN and CRASH, both picture books published by Guardian Angel Publishing.
I'm also the co-author of the nonfiction work, The Slippery Art of Book Reviewing, published by Twilight Times Books.
